Blues rally in third period

St. Louis scored three third-period goals Thursday night to rally for a 3-2 victory at Winnipeg in Game 5 of the Western Conference quarterfinals. After trailing 2-0 through two periods, Ryan O’Reilly cut the deficit in half on the power play 1:29 into the third period with assists courtesy of David Perron and Brayden Schenn. Schenn tied the score at 2-2 with 6:31 remaining on a goal assisted by Oskar Sundqvist and Jay Bouwmeester. With 15 seconds remaining in regulation, Justin Schwartz provided the game-winning goal on an assist from Tyler Bozak. Jordan Binnington recorded 29 saves on 31 shots in the winning effort.

Jets collapse in final 20 minutes

Winnipeg fell 3-2 Thursday night at home versus St. Louis in Game 5 to fall behind 3-2 in the series. Adam Lowry gave the Jets a 1-0 advantage only 12 seconds in on a goal assisted by Brandon Tanev and Andrew Copp. Kevin Hayes made it a 2-0 game with 6:25 remaining in the first period on an assist from Dustin Byfuglien. After a scoreless second period, the Blues scored three in the third including the winner with 15 seconds left to overtake the hosts. Connor Hellebuyck registered 26 saves on 29 shots in the defeat.
